WRS Health review conversion rate tracking by provider
Raw review counts mislead you about actual performance. A practice with 200 reviews from 10,000 patient encounters has a 2% conversion rate, while a competitor with 80 reviews from 1,000 encounters achieves 8%. The second practice wins more patients. Because Reviewflowz connects to WRS Health encounter data, it calculates your true review conversion rate: reviews collected divided by patient visits. See which providers, locations, and service types generate the most patient feedback. The average Reviewflowz customer achieves a 7.5% conversion rate across all patient interactions.

How do you measure review performance for WRS Health practices?
Review conversion rate matters more than total review count. This equals reviews collected divided by patient encounters, which Reviewflowz calculates automatically using WRS Health data. A practice with 60 reviews from 800 patients (7.5% conversion) will outperform a competitor with 300 reviews from 8,000 patients (3.75% conversion). Higher conversion rates signal better patient experiences and more effective review collection processes. Track conversion rates by provider, service type, and location to identify what drives the most positive patient feedback.
